summaryrefslogtreecommitdiffstats
path: root/backend_common.c
AgeCommit message (Expand)AuthorFilesLines
2018-02-16common: Use CUPS_BACKEND_RETRY for most error situations.Solomon Peachy1-6/+7
2018-02-16common: set 'connecting-to-device' state approriately.Solomon Peachy1-1/+10
2018-02-16common: Set the altsetting only if there's more than one option.Solomon Peachy1-3/+6
2018-02-16common: Allow for a variable number of claim attempts.Solomon Peachy1-25/+27
2018-01-09common: don't issue an altsetting if not necessary.Solomon Peachy1-7/+11
2017-11-25Trailing whitespace fixes.Solomon Peachy1-2/+2
2017-11-17All: Add 'SPDX-License-Identifier' headers to all source files.Solomon Peachy1-0/+2
2017-11-08all: Clean up the manufacturer override field in the devices.Solomon Peachy1-3/+3
2017-11-08common: Numerous improvements to device enumerationSolomon Peachy1-52/+86
2017-08-06Initial magiccard commit.Solomon Peachy1-0/+2
2017-08-06common: Handle wildcard USB PIDs from a given vendor (use pid of 0xffff)Solomon Peachy1-2/+3
2017-07-10Fix up bad whitespacing.Solomon Peachy1-7/+7
2017-05-05Merge a pile spelling fixes from Ville Skyttä <scop@sf>Solomon Peachy1-1/+1
2017-04-19common: Add ability to override USB transfer limit and timeouts.Solomon Peachy1-5/+15
2017-03-01Doc updates.Solomon Peachy1-2/+2
2017-01-13It's now 2017; Update copyright year for the code that's seen changes.Solomon Peachy1-3/+3
2017-01-12common: don't log PAGE counts if being used in CUPS context, asSolomon Peachy1-3/+5
2016-12-15Get rid of some extra semicolons.Solomon Peachy1-1/+1
2016-12-03mitsup95d: Add in support for the Mitsubishi P95D.Solomon Peachy1-0/+2
2016-12-02canonselphyneo: Add a new backend for the CP820/910/1000/1200 printers.Solomon Peachy1-0/+2
2016-12-02common: Minor internal rearrangement to make future changes simpler.Solomon Peachy1-3/+4
2016-11-17common: Fix querying of the IEEE1284 string when per-interface classes are u...Solomon Peachy1-29/+41
2016-11-01common: Only claim the interface once when probing.Solomon Peachy1-49/+44
2016-10-31mitsu70x: Figured out lifetime print count!Solomon Peachy1-0/+14
2016-10-26common: don't retry the interface claiming if it's not a BUSY error.Solomon Peachy1-2/+4
2016-10-20common: Pull a couple of unnecessary globals into main().Solomon Peachy1-4/+3
2016-10-09common: Replace a magic number with a libusb-defined sysmbolSolomon Peachy1-2/+4
2016-09-20commmon: Fix help text.Solomon Peachy1-1/+1
2016-09-01common: Use the first instead of last matching set of bulk endpointsSolomon Peachy1-1/+5
2016-08-16common: Log the page counts with the 'PAGE' log target.Solomon Peachy1-3/+6
2016-07-19common: Fix a memory leak in the libusb code.Solomon Peachy1-3/+9
2016-07-14Common: Get rid of the -S, -V, -P, -T options.Solomon Peachy1-3/+1
2016-01-24whitspace cleanups.Solomon Peachy1-17/+16
2016-01-24all: It's 2016 now, update the copyright text.Solomon Peachy1-3/+3
2015-11-17common: One more fix.Solomon Peachy1-1/+1
2015-11-17common: fix the last commit.Solomon Peachy1-4/+1
2015-11-17common: Fix a memory leak.Solomon Peachy1-1/+2
2015-09-13bump a couple of things.Solomon Peachy1-1/+1
2015-09-13common: Get rid of an unused variable.Solomon Peachy1-5/+1
2015-08-29common: Export current page to backends.Solomon Peachy1-5/+5
2015-08-25common: move uint16_to_packed_bcd() into common code.Solomon Peachy1-2/+23
2015-08-13all: Eliminate the multi-stage cmdline parsing.Solomon Peachy1-92/+32
2015-08-12all: Unified approach to extra_vid/pid/typeSolomon Peachy1-1/+38
2015-08-12common: Eliminate early_parse() from backend.Solomon Peachy1-88/+66
2015-08-12common: Rework the early cmdline argument parsing code to improve robustnessSolomon Peachy1-123/+140
2015-07-26shinko6145: Add a preliminary backend. Does NOT include library work.Solomon Peachy1-0/+1
2015-07-04all: Clean up a small pile of warnings that clang-analyzer found.Solomon Peachy1-3/+7
2015-07-04misc: Fix some unitialized variable warnings that show up with -OsSolomon Peachy1-1/+1
2015-07-04misc: Clean up buffer overflows identified by cppcheckSolomon Peachy1-0/+3
2015-07-04common: A few minor cleanups.Solomon Peachy1-11/+9